About

The Man in the Park 2: The Second Man in the Park is a single player simulation game with a horror theme. It was developed by Elliott Dahle and was released on August 17, 2025. It received very positive reviews from players.

The Man in the Park 2: The Second Man in the Park is a short, multiple ending horror game where you try to make it out of your neighborhood park . . . alive . . . again. FEATURES Six possible endings (double the amount from the first game!) New environments Classic big-screen jump scares Can be completed in a single sitting (average playtime ~20 minutes)

  • Significant improvement over the first game with roughly double the content and multiple endings.
  • Engaging and clever storytelling with a humorous and self-aware tone that many players enjoyed.
  • Simple controls and accessible gameplay that make it easy to experience, complemented by decent visuals and atmosphere.
  • Gameplay is considered boring and uninteresting by some, lacking depth and challenge.
  • Fails to balance horror and comedy effectively, resulting in an atmosphere that is neither scary nor genuinely funny.
  • Short overall length, with some players finding it too brief or not worthwhile despite being free.
